Asimov cribbed it from Toynbee, who did the World History Magnum Opus before the Durants but after JG Frazer. "Civilizations die from suicide, not by murder." He wrote 12 volumes to prove his point. The quote is at the beginning of Volume 4, which I have around here somewhere, but haven't quite been able to stomach.

Of course, the thought wasn't original to him, either, nor Thomas Cole,

Nor Gibbon.
